Thermal cutting processes

 

 

The thermal cutting is a very common process applied in industries today. While there are many types of thermal cutting processes, the most popular is probably oxy-fuel. The reason as to why it is so popular is its capability of cutting different thicknesses from 0.5 mm to 250 mm. the best thing is that the equipment comes at a very low cost. The other thing that makes it such a viable option is the fact that you have the option to use it manually or in a mechanized way. There are different nozzle and fuel gas designs that you can settle for and this actually helps in enhancing the performance considered in terms of cutting speed and cut quality. Thermal cutting is a very interesting process and can be well illustrated by the use of an oxy-fuel torch. In such a circumstance, the metal is pre heat using fuel gas mixed with oxygen. The metal is heated to the ignition temperature. For steel, the ignition temperature stands at 700 degrees C to 900 degrees, usually, it turns bright red heat. This temperature is however below the melting point. On the pre heated area, jet of oxygen is directed in its purest form. This instigates a very vigorous exothermic chemical reaction between the metal and oxygen. Slag or iron oxide is formed. The oxygen is able to blow away the slag and prices the material and cuts through the material. This is how thermal cutting works.

Cutting is very important especially when you are looking to remove defects, making the weld joint preparations, removing waste materials as well as producing different sheets sizes. There are a number of processes that can help achieve this. Thermal cutting invokes oxygen cutting, plasma, laser cutting, and spark erosion. Other options include hydraulic and mechanical.
